The Making of Cate Tiernan

Born on July 24, 1961, in New Orleans, Louisiana, Cate Tiernan grew up in a city steeped in mystery and magic. As a child, she roamed 'Cities of the Dead'—New Orleans’ aboveground cemeteries—piecing together stories from tombstones. This early fascination with history and narrative shaped her imaginative storytelling. She studied writing and Russian literature at New York University before transferring to Loyola University in New Orleans, earning a degree in Russian. Her career began at Random House in New York, where she wrote children’s books and even helped edit L.J. Smith’s 'The Secret Circle.' After years in Manhattan, she returned to New Orleans, married, and began her family, later settling in Durham, North Carolina.

Cate Tiernan’s Unforgettable Stories

Tiernan’s breakout hit, the 'Sweep' series (also known as 'Wicca' in some regions), launched in 2001 with 'Book of Shadows.' This 15-book saga follows Morgan Rowlands, a teenage girl who discovers she’s a blood witch descended from a powerful lineage. Blending Wiccan rituals with supernatural drama, the series explores identity, romance, and the moral complexities of power. Its realistic teen dynamics and vivid magical systems earned praise from outlets like Booklist and a spot on the American Library Association’s Quick Picks for Reluctant Young Adult Readers in 2002.

Beyond 'Sweep,' Tiernan’s 'Balefire' series (2005–2006) dives into New Orleans’ mystical underbelly, following twin witches Clio and Thais as they navigate a magical destiny. Her 'Immortal Beloved' trilogy (2010–2012) introduces Nastasya, an immortal seeking redemption, showcasing Tiernan’s knack for flawed, relatable heroines. Tiernan’s style—lush, sensory, and emotionally raw—draws from influences like Barbara Hambly and P.D. James, blending Southern gothic vibes with universal coming-of-age themes.

Though not a Wiccan herself, Tiernan relates to its woman-centered spirituality, infusing her stories with authentic yet accessible depictions of magic. Her ability to ground fantastical plots in real-world emotions makes her work resonate with teens and adults alike, creating worlds where magic feels tantalizingly possible.

Why Cate Tiernan Matters

Cate Tiernan’s impact lies in her ability to make young adult paranormal fiction both thrilling and introspective. Her stories tackle heavy themes—identity, betrayal, and self-discovery—while celebrating the strength of young women. The 'Sweep' series, in particular, inspired a generation of readers to explore Wicca and paganism, with fans on platforms like Reddit still praising its immersive magic system. In 2010, Universal even optioned 'Sweep' for a potential TV series, a testament to its cultural footprint. Tiernan’s New Orleans roots add a unique flavor, making her a standout in a genre often dominated by generic settings.

Her legacy endures through her relatable characters and atmospheric storytelling, encouraging readers to find magic in their own lives. With over 75 books under various pseudonyms, Tiernan’s versatility and prolific output cement her as a quiet giant in young adult fiction.
